Visit the new Museu del Modernisme, which has opened in 2010. It is housed in a former textile factory in the centre of Barcelona, and offers visitors the chance to enjoy a cultural centre dedicated exclusively to modernista art.
The holdings of the new Museu del Modernisme de Barcelona (MMCat) come from the private collection that two Barcelona antique dealers, Fernando Pinos and Maria Guirao, have amassed during their 40 years in the business. The museum is dedicated exclusively to Catalonias home-grown-art-nouveau movement, modernisme. The collection on shows consists of 350 works by 42 of the most representive modernista artists, including Joan Busquets, Ramon Casas, Antoni Gaudi, Gaspar Homar, Josep Llimona, Joaquim Mir and Puig i Cadafalch, in their different disciplines: painting, sculpture, furniture and the decorative arts.
